  1. Sin & the City: William Hogarth's London is on exhibit at Princeton University's Firestone Library, 9 a.m. to 5 p.m., Free.  
  2. Mercer County Board of Elections will unveil its proposed new election district map for a consolidated Princeton Township and Princeton Borough, Princeton Township Building, 400 Witherspoon Street, 5:30 p.m., Free.
  3. Princeton Township Committee will include an progress report about the township's leaf and brush collection, Princeton Township Building, 400 Witherspoon Street, 7 p.m., Free. 
  4. Hawaiian-born Jake Shimabukuro plays the ukelele at playing everything fro pop tunes (like Queen’s Bohemian Rhapsody), American songbook standards, and his own originals, with influences ranging from Hendrix to Bach. 8 p.m., Call 609-258-ARTS (2787) for tickets. 
  5. Today it will be mostly sunny with a high near 48 degrees with wind gusts up to 17 mph. Overnight will be mostly cloudy with a low around 32 degrees.
